#db383f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db383f is composed of 85.9% red, 22%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.4%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 357.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 53.9%. #db383f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ff707e with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#db383f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#db383f has RGB values of R:219, G:56,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.71,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14366783.

Shades and Tints of #db383f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cefef is the lightest one.

Tones of #db383f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8989 is the less saturated color, while #f61d26 is the most saturated one.
